    Review of Fatigue Crack Propagation under Variable Amplitude Loading

    • Mechanical structures mainly bear fatigue loading, especially variable amplitude loading in the engineering. In this article, the current frequently-used crack propagation models and theories under variable amplitude loading were analyzed in detail, including induced plastic closure theory, crack tip passivation theory and residual compressive stress theory. The current frequently-used models can obtain relatively accurate results in predicting single or multimodal overload fatigue crack propagation life. But in high load ration and taking the component thickness effects into account, there tend to be big errors. Every model has its own basis of theory, premise condition and application area. In the practical engineering application, proper models should be chosen according to different conditions. The prediction accuracy of the models under high load ration or large scale yielding of crack tip will be emphasized in the future. Based on this paper, the readers can know about the application area of the prediction models and their simplified versions so that proper models can be used to obtain relatively accurate results.
